答:本文主要涉及如何使用JDBC连接MySQL数据库,并详细介绍了配置数据源的方法和步骤。
问:JDBC是什么?
nectivity,是Java语言操作数据库的标准API。它提供了一套用于连接和操作数据库的接口,使得Java程序可以方便地访问各种关系型数据库。
问:如何使用JDBC连接MySQL数据库?
答:使用JDBC连接MySQL数据库需要以下步骤:
eysql.jdbc.Driver");
nectionnagernectioname, password);
entententtnent();
t.executeQuery(sql);
ext()){...}
tn.close();
问:什么是数据源?
答:数据源是一种管理数据库连接的机制,它可以提供连接池、事务管理、连接超时等功能。数据源可以在应用程序启动时被初始化并保存在一个容器中,应用程序需要连接数据库时,直接从容器中获取数据源即可。
问:如何配置数据源?
答:配置数据源需要以下步骤:
l中添加以下依赖:
dency>.alibaba
druid>dency>
.properties中添加以下配置:
gysql://localhost:3306/testgame=rootg.datasource.password=123456gameysql.jdbc.Driver
g Boot,可以使用@Autowired注解将数据源注入到代码中。
问:使用数据源有什么好处?
答:使用数据源可以提高数据库连接的效率和可靠性。数据源可以管理连接池,使得连接可以被重复利用,避免了频繁地创建和销毁连接的开销。同时,数据源可以提供连接超时、事务管理等功能,使得连接更加可靠和安全。